#RandomWritingPrompt from Brown Bag Lit:

Name the colors in your piece. Imagine you are standing in the scene / moment and name the colors you see. Come up with at least three names for each color.

Today's #RandomWritingPrompt from Brown Bag Lit:

Ekphrastic writing is writing in response to art.

While the Smithsonian museums are closed during the shutdown, their websites and open access materials remain available. Choose something that catches your eye and write in response to it.

#RandomWritingPrompt: There are many different kinds of languages, including constructed languages (like Esperanto.)

Imagine your own constructed language and write either a word or two and its definition (in your language :-) or a sentence in your constructed language and the translation.
